For heads of department: the licensing dispute with Ferrow Analytics over the Cindertrack module remains unresolved. We have provisioned for the contested royalties across two quarters, and external counsel advises a settlement range consistent with that provision. Cash impact is manageable, but renewal negotiations on adjacent contracts should be paused until the matter closes. Department leads should route related queries through the finance office. The confidential business note appears directly below.

management briefing: Only 5 of the 80 pilot accounts renewed Zorix, so a churn review is set for October 1.

## Local Setup

Paylode v4 changes the payroll export from fixed-width to CSV. The exporter now reads column mappings from `export_map.yml`; review that file first. Run `make seed` to load the Kestrelworks sample ledger before testing. The diff touches `exporter.go` only. To reproduce locally, point the exporter at the staging replica using the connection string below.

primary connection of yagep-kahip = redis://giliel_svc:zYiKsLL2PLpfPL@db-348f.xolmarsys.corp:5432/fenwyn

## Changelog — v4.8.0 (Key Rotation)

Rotated the signing key for the Driftpost parcel-tracking webhook. Old key is revoked effective this release; payloads signed with it will fail verification. Contractors: update your verification config before consuming webhook events, or deliveries will bounce. No payload schema changes. Rotation cadence is now quarterly. See the webhook integration guide for verification steps. The new webhook signing key follows.

rollout seal: bky4_x7Gc

When the Swiftmark parcel-tracking webhook stops delivering events, first confirm the endpoint health check in the Relaygate dashboard, then inspect the dead-letter queue for rejected payloads. Replay only after verifying the consumer schema version matches. Replays are issued against the internal Relaygate replay endpoint, which requires authentication. Use the service key that appears directly below.

gateway credential: kto3_qfe